A worker at a poultry processing plant in Center suffered a finger amputation while trying to clear a conveyor belt jam, leading to $263,498 in proposed fines against the company from the U.S. Occupational Safety and Health Administration.
OSHA cited Tyson Foods for two repeated and 15 serious violations, the agency announced Tuesday. Headquartered in Springdale, Arkansas, Tyson is the world's largest meat and poultry processing company, with more than $40 billion in annual sales. The company has 15 days to contest the citations.
